TECHNICAL FIELD

[0001] The utility model relates to the field of home textile, especially to the silk quilt. BACKGROUND

[0002] The quilt cover of the existing silk quilt is mostly single-layer structure. In the use process, after long-term pulling, tumbling, rubbing, washing and the like, the phenomenon that silk threads are drilled out of the quilt cover appears, which reduces the service life of the product and affects the user experience. [0018] Referring to Figure 1 , the double-layer anti-silk-drilling silk quilt cover includes a quilt cover and a filler 3 filled in the quilt cover. The filler 3 is mulberry silk or tussah silk. The quilt cover has two layers, which are an inner layer and an outer layer. The inner layer is located between the outer layer and the silk.

[0019] Preferably, the inner layer is made of full polyester spunlace non-woven fabric or full polyester knitted fabric. The outer layer is not limited. Preferably, the material of the inner layer is different from that of the outer layer.

[0020] Embodiment 1

[0021] The double-layer anti-silk-drilling silk quilt cover is a summer quilt cover, the inner layer is 35g full polyester spunlace non-woven fabric, and the outer layer is pure cotton fabric.

[0022] Embodiment 2

[0023] The double-layer anti-silk-drilling silk quilt cover is a spring and autumn quilt cover, the inner layer is 85g full polyester knitted fabric, and the outer layer is flocked fabric.

[0024] Yes, the outer layer is a four-edge stitched quilt cover. To avoid misalignment between the inner layer, silk, and the outer layer in use, a limiting structure needs to be set between two or three of them. For example: the inner layer, the outer layer, and the filler are connected together by quilting thread. The quilting thread directly penetrates the three. For another example, an observation port is opened on the edge of the quilt cover. The four edges of the inner layer and the outer layer, except for the observation port, are stitched together, including the upper layer of the inner layer, the lower layer of the inner layer, the upper layer of the outer layer, and the lower layer of the outer layer. The upper layer of the inner layer and the upper layer of the outer layer are stitched together at the observation port, and the lower layer of the inner layer and the lower layer of the outer layer are stitched together. For example, the edges of the inner layer and the outer layer are stitched together or the positioning buckles at the four corners, etc. For another example: the inner layer and the outer layer are set at equal intervals. The connecting points are set between them. Thus, it prevents misalignment between the inner layer and the outer layer. The connecting points can be quilting, hot pressing points, adhesive points, etc. Preferably, the inner layer and the outer layer are set at equal intervals with hot pressing points.

[0025] Also, one of the four edges of the inner layer is a folded edge, and the remaining three edges are stitched edges. One of the four edges of the outer layer is a folded edge, and the remaining three edges are stitched edges. When producing, the fabric is folded in half from the middle, and the folded edge is formed at the folded part. Thus, the number of stitched edges is reduced, and the effect of preventing the quilt from being drilled is further improved. Preferably, the folded edge of the inner layer is misaligned with the folded edge of the outer layer, and the effect of preventing the quilt from being drilled is further improved.

[0026] Scheme 1: The folded edge of the inner layer 2 is located on the left side. The folded edge of the outer layer 1 is located at the head of the quilt. The edges of the inner layer 2 located at the head are stitched together to form the stitched edges. The edges of the outer layer 1 located on the right side are stitched together to form the stitched edges. The edge of the inner layer 2 located on the right side is stitched together with the edge of the outer layer 1 located on the right side to form the right stitched edge. The edge of the inner layer 2 located at the foot of the quilt is stitched together with the edge of the outer layer 1 located at the foot of the quilt to form the bottom stitched edge. At least one of the right stitched edge or the bottom stitched edge is sewn with a zipper. To open through the zipper and allow the consumer to observe the internal material.

[0027] Scheme 2: The folded edge of the inner layer is located on the left side. The folded edge of the outer layer is located on the right side. The edge of the inner layer located at the head of the quilt and the edge of the outer layer located at the head of the quilt are stitched together to form the top stitched edge. The edge of the inner layer located at the foot of the quilt is stitched together with the edge of the outer layer located at the foot of the quilt to form the bottom stitched edge. The edges of the outer layer located on the left side are stitched together to form the stitched edges. The edges of the inner layer located on the right side are stitched together to form the stitched edges. The bottom stitched edge is sewn with a zipper. To open through the zipper and allow the consumer to observe the internal material.

[0028] Alternatively, the inner layer of the duvet cover can be folded in half along both the left and right sides, and the edges at the head and foot of the duvet can be sewn together, with the center of the inner layer sewn together. Or, the inner layer of the duvet cover can be folded in half along both the head and foot sides, and the edges at the left and right sides can be sewn together, with the center of the inner layer sewn together. During production, two pieces of fabric are folded in half and then the edges at the center of the duvet cover are sewn together. This method can further stagger the sewn edges, thereby further improving the effect of preventing down leakage.

[0029] In all the above solutions, heat pressing can be used instead of sewing. Preferably, in all the above solutions, an observation opening is provided on the quilt surface, and a single-sided overlocked lining is provided at the observation opening. The lining is then hand-stitched to the filling.
